What is FaceReader

FaceReader is an emotion AI software product that analyzes facial expressions from video to estimate affective states and related behavioral metrics. It is used by researchers and applied teams for user research, market research, and behavioral science studies where facial response is a data source. The product is commonly deployed in lab or controlled study settings and can be combined with other biometric or stimulus data in research workflows. It is positioned as a dedicated facial-expression analysis tool rather than a general-purpose computer vision platform.

pros

Research-oriented facial coding

FaceReader is designed for structured studies that require consistent facial-expression measurement across participants and sessions. It supports workflows typical in academic and commercial research, such as analyzing recorded sessions and producing quantitative outputs. This focus can reduce the amount of custom model-building needed compared with general-purpose vision APIs. It also aligns well with experimental protocols where traceability and repeatability matter.

Works with recorded video

The product can analyze facial expressions from recorded video, which fits common usability testing and market research setups. This enables teams to collect data in one step and run analysis later, rather than requiring real-time integration. It also supports re-analysis when study parameters change, which is useful for iterative research. This approach can be simpler than building a bespoke pipeline around raw computer vision tooling.

Specialized emotion metrics output

FaceReader provides emotion-related outputs derived from facial expression analysis, which can be used directly in reporting and statistical analysis. For teams focused on affect measurement, this can be more immediately usable than platforms that primarily return low-level detections. The specialization helps when the goal is to compare emotional response across stimuli, segments, or participant groups. It is commonly used as a component within broader behavioral measurement stacks.

cons

Inference validity constraints

Facial-expression-based emotion inference has known limitations, including cultural variation, individual differences, and context dependence. Results may not generalize well outside controlled conditions or without careful study design and validation. Teams often need complementary signals (e.g., self-report, physiology, or context data) to interpret findings responsibly. This can increase the effort required to produce defensible conclusions.

Privacy and consent overhead

Because it processes identifiable facial video, deployments typically require strong consent, data minimization, and retention controls. Regulatory and ethics requirements can be significant, especially for studies involving minors, sensitive topics, or cross-border data transfers. Organizations may need additional governance and security measures beyond what is required for non-biometric analytics. These constraints can limit where and how the tool is used.

Less suited for broad CV

FaceReader is purpose-built for facial expression and affect analysis rather than general computer vision tasks. Teams needing object detection, scene understanding, or highly customized model training may find it less flexible than broader AI platforms. Integration into production applications may require additional engineering compared with end-to-end customer analytics suites. As a result, it is often used as a research component rather than a general AI layer.

Plan & Pricing

Noldus FaceReader (desktop) — Tiered plans

Plan Price Key features & notes
Essential $2,000 Automated emotion analysis: analyze universal expressions, immediate results and visualizations. (As listed on Noldus FaceReader Options page.)
Advanced $12,000 Includes everything in Essential plus: Action Units (FACS), vital signs (PPG), gaze tracking, voice intensity, multi-face analysis, infant (Baby FaceReader) support.
Premium Contact sales Multiple licenses (three seats) + dedicated customer success manager; designed for teams and research at scale.

FaceReader Online — Usage-based / credit (minute)-based pricing

Pricing model: Pay-as-you-go (minute/credit-based) with optional annual bundles and complete-service project packages. Free tier/trial: Free trial account available (time-limited trial account for evaluation). Example costs / bundles:

  • Small Remote Lab: €190 per month (billed annually at €2,280) — 2,000 minutes/year.
  • Remote Lab: €340 per month (billed annually at €4,080) — 6,000 minutes/year.
  • Unlimited Remote Lab: €790 per month (billed annually at €9,480) — unlimited minutes; includes FaceReader for Windows (1-year license); subject to fair use. Pay-as-you-go / per-minute: €2.50 per minute with a minimum purchase of 200 minutes (€500 minimum purchase). All online prices exclude VAT. Complete service (project) starting prices (examples listed on site): Basic project €2,460; Custom project starting €4,000; Premium project €7,480.

Notes: All pricing and feature descriptions above are taken directly from the vendor official websites (Noldus and FaceReader Online). Where a plan states "contact sales" the vendor page directs contacting sales for quotes.
